Anyway, if the pt is good and no accidents happen the warrior shouldn't even come very close to death. If the warrior dies and the mages still have MP it is as much the party's fault.
And all the other mages like the blm with whm sub (or anybody who can cure) should always play support healer instead of nuke nuke nuke nuke and forget about supporting the whm. It is true if you are a blm or rdm your job is also to squish the mob with your fancy black magic, but support healing is VERY important (NA blms who only nuke end up getting a bad rep with JP who prefer supportive blms). Sometimes the whm can't take ALL the stress if the damage is a little too much during accidents/emergencies.
Although, it -is- true that in the case of a bad pull or freak accident the tank should be the first to die.
